We all have dark shadows

We all have dark shadows. Sometimes they have little influence. Other times they have much influence. Regardless, they are just shadows. They are not who we really are. Learning to separate self-criticism, guilt, and the other negative emotions from who we really are is very healthy. Imagine these negative emotions to be a cloud way over there in a blue sky floating across the sky and finally disappearing. Or see them like images in a dream. When we wake up and see them as false, and in fact non-existent. In this way we become more whole and happier human beings.
